Transaction 4dd0934ce05128d439ae26bb0ec74923c048af75274a1b3e39c80541ee1ccc60
1 Input
1 Output
-
4dd0934ce05128d439ae26bb0ec74923c048af75274a1b3e39c80541ee1ccc60:0
- value
- 20411291
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d04882419f59a6e09b0bbd89e5c1cc802528e75
- address
- bc1q85zgsfqe7kdxuzdsh0vfuhqueqp99rn4cezag0